The six on-chain and off-chain signals that separate a real, usable ERC-8004 AI agent from a paper registration — identity, ReputationRegistry feedback (Sybil-adjusted), x402 and settlement history, cross-chain presence, and live reachability. Vendor-neutral checklist you can apply on any chain.
